Abstract
Interaction of perfluorobenzocyclobutene with two equivalents of 1,3,5-trifluorobenzene in an SbF medium followed by the treatment of the reaction mixture with water gave (3,4,5,6-tetrafluorobenzene-1,2-diyl)bis[(2,4,6-trifluorophenyl)methanone], 1-(2,4,6-trifluorophenyl)-perfluorobenzocyclobuten-1-ol and 4,5,6,7-tetrafluoro-1,3,3-tris(2,4,6-trifluorophenyl)-1,3-dihydro-2-benzofuran-1-ol. When the reaction mixture was treated with HF, 1,2-bis(2,4,6-trifluorophenyl)-perfluorobenzocyclobutene along with 1-(2,4,6-trifluorophenyl)perfluorobenzocyclobutene were obtained. The latter compound reacted with pentafluoro-, 1,2,3,4- or 1,2,4,5-tetrafluorobenzenes in an SbF medium to give corresponding polyfluoro-1,2-diphenylbenzocyclobutenes after treatment of the reaction mixture with HF.
